Output 0f59b632a8ed325ed344dae74427cc544d09fe644228070f1b7d2629cd8484ab:11

value
21201916
script pubkey
OP_HASH160 OP_PUSHBYTES_20 348cfa32e81fe4be92bb49f31b3e7e693f2b792a OP_EQUAL
address
MCh2FgYc4u7HYkBrT39JQDx38HmEtkv7We
transaction
0f59b632a8ed325ed344dae74427cc544d09fe644228070f1b7d2629cd8484ab
spent
true